Connect6 Pente hybrid?
Posted: Nov 5, 2024, 7:21 PM

I suspect this type of idea has come up previously, but here's perhaps a new twist- it's non colinear stone placement on the same turn. Connect5 instwad of connect6, and Pente style pair captures allowed. This came up recently in the Pente discord group. I'm interested in hearing what C6/Pente crossover players think of it. Re: Connect6 Pente hybrid?
Posted: Jun 23, 2026, 8:40 AM

I've now made an app which allows exploration of this idea. It has two variants. Variant one allows overlines (five or more) to win and variant two allows them to be played, but they don't win. In variant two, in the rare case where one player places a winning stone which also creates a five in a row for their opponent by removing an end overline stone, the game ends in a draw. The app is on a 15x15 board with black playing first. Especially with variant two, the game becomes similar to ninuki renju, with forbidden stone placement losses and edge case draws. Perhaps, I will add a third variant which incorporates the Boat rule, where a five mist be unbreakable (perfect) to count as a win to make it even more ninuki like.

Re: Connect6 Pente hybrid?
Posted: Jun 30, 2026, 4:32 PM

Frankly, I don't remember exactly.
Maybe I recall it wrongly (we played several games and I may mess this one with some other) but it felt quite drawish from a certain point; maybe there is some advantage to be caught in the opening stage, maybe we are too weak to feel it but that's what I remember. Or maybe it was impression about Ujner?..

I'd say we end up with the idea that in the midgame and lategame the main winning idea is "forcing a foul", getting situation when you play two fours which your opp can't close because defending moves are collinear. Winning with a classic attack seemed almost impossible if your opp is accurate enough.
